I don't much care for the look (or price) of the current offering of metal rear fender bibs. My rear fender had marks from almost 10 years of rear seat pressure that I couldn't rub out. I ordered a leather fender bib from mustangseats.com and it carries their P/n 78030. It was made for a Sportster Xl 1982-2003. I bought the plain bib but they also offer a studded bib. It cost $33 plus shipping. The bib is 5.5" wide and 15" long and has two holes. One is a slot where it fits under the driver seat retaining bolt and the other is a hole where the rear seat retaining bolt goes (M6). The slot allows about 1/8" adjustment front to back with the bolt through it and the bib fits like it was custom made for my bike. I think it looks sweet!
